high school graduation announcement wording


We are pleased to announce the graduation of [Graduate's Name] from [High School Name] on [Date] at [Time], at [Location]. Please join us in celebrating this milestone.

[Graduate's Name] has graduated from [High School Name]! You're invited to the ceremony on [Date] at [Time], held at [Location]. Let's celebrate together.

Join us in honoring [Graduate's Name]'s high school graduation from [High School Name] on [Date] at [Time] at [Location]. Your presence would mean the world to us.

Celebrate [Graduate's Name]'s achievement as they graduate from [High School Name] on [Date] at [Time] at [Location]. We look forward to sharing this special day with you.

graduation announcement wording no party


We are proud to announce that [Graduate's Name] has graduated from [School Name] with a [Degree, e.g., Bachelor of Arts] on [Date].

[Graduate's Name] is delighted to share their graduation from [School Name] on [Date], earning a [Degree].

Please join us in congratulating [Graduate's Name] on completing their studies at [School Name] and receiving their [Degree] on [Date].

[Graduate's Name] has successfully graduated from [School Name] with a [Degree] on [Date] – a milestone achievement.

Warm congratulations to [Graduate's Name] for graduating from [School Name] on [Date] with their [Degree].
